THE ESSENTIAL MIDDLE SCHOOL SURVIVAL GUIDE

The Core Skills Every Middle Schooler Should Know to Become a Confident, Happy, and Successful Teen!

Welcome to the middle school journey!

This exciting phase in your child's life is full of changes, new experiences, and opportunities. They'll be making new friends, taking on more responsibilities, and exploring their independence. But it can be a bit of a rollercoaster too. Juggling homework, managing time, coping with emotions, and navigating social groups can be tricky for them (and for you!).

It's a unique time. They've left the guided world of elementary school, and they're learning to take on more tasks, make decisions, and build relationships, all while balancing school and personal life. This can sometimes feel overwhelming and can lead to doubts and anxiety. It's a bit like learning to ride a bike but not yet knowing how to balance.

What they really need is a helpful guide.

And that's exactly what "Success Skills for Middle Schoolers" provides.

This friendly and approachable guide equips your child with the practical skills they need to thrive. From managing time and staying organized to communicating effectively, building a growth mindset, and taking care of their emotions, this book covers it all.

Our goal is to empower your child not just to survive middle school but to really enjoy this special time and prepare for the years ahead. If you appreciate clear, practical, and real-world advice, you'll love this book.

Über den Autor
Ferne Bowe is a parent, marketing professional, and author of Money Skills for Kids.With two kids of her own, she has first-hand experience with the challenges and triumphs of raising a kid.While watching her kids growing up, she noticed the gap between the skills kids need to thrive in the real world and what they are taught in school. For example, she noted that while kids are often taught how to get good grades, they are rarely taught how to manage their finances or have difficult conversations.She is on a mission to close that gap and help kids, and young adults find their purpose, develop self-awareness and confidence, and build their skills to create a life they love.Her message is simple: Mastering life skills and taking ownership of day-to-day tasks is the key to success, no matter your goals. Adopting this principle helps kids develop the skills they need to live a successful life.
